EDITORS COMMENTS
In this image from H.G. Wells' classic science fiction novel, "The War of the Worlds," Brazilian illustrator Alvin Wyss Corrêa depicts a human figure intently observing a Martian fighting machine. Published for the first time in 1898, this haunting scene captures the sense of wonder and fear that gripped the world when the idea of extraterrestrial life became a reality in the pages of this groundbreaking novel. The human observer, with a determined expression on his face, carefully checks the Martian's hood (cap) to ensure that the being inside is indeed from Mars. The Martian, with its shadowy, menacing form and long, spindly limbs, creeps ominously in the background, its eyes glowing with an otherworldly light. The image perfectly encapsulates the sense of quiet observation and careful scrutiny that would be necessary in the face of an alien invasion. Corrêa's illustration is a testament to the enduring power of Wells' story, which continues to captivate and inspire generations of readers and filmmakers. The image invites us to imagine what it would be like to encounter an alien being for the first time, and to consider the implications of such an encounter for humanity. With its intricate details and atmospheric composition, this print invites us to step into the world of "The War of the Worlds" and to explore the wonders and terrors of the universe beyond our own.
